Who we are Founded in 1978, Al Marwan Group is a diversified organization serving the construction, heavy machinery, Oil & Gas, real estate, developments and Hospitality sectors across the GCC. The Group operates through multiple business units and subsidiaries, delivering integrated solutions supported by strong operational expertise and a well-established regional presence. Job Summary The Foreman for the Caterpillar section will oversee daily workshop operations, ensuring the efficient maintenance, repair, and servicing of heavy machinery equipment. This role involves supervising a team of technicians, ensuring adherence to safety standards, and maintaining operational productivity in alignment with company objectives. Key Responsibilities The key duties and responsibilities of the Foreman include, but are not limited to: Supervise and coordinate the work of technicians in the Caterpillar section to ensure timely and quality maintenance and repairs. Plan, schedule, and prioritize workshop activities to meet operational deadlines. Ensure compliance with safety, quality, and environmental regulations. Conduct inspections, troubleshoot technical issues, and provide technical guidance to the team. Liaise with management to report progress, challenges, and recommendations for workflow improvements. Implement continuous improvement practices to enhance operational efficiency and reduce downtime. Required Skills & Qualifications Education: Diploma or degree in Mechanical Engineering, Heavy Equipment Technology, or related field. Experience: 6–8 years in heavy machinery maintenance and repair, with at least 2 years in a foreman role, preferably in Caterpillar machinery. In-depth knowledge of Caterpillar heavy equipment operations and maintenance. Strong troubleshooting, diagnostic, and problem-solving abilities. Proficiency in workshop safety standards and mechanical best practices. Leadership and team management skills. Strong communication and reporting abilities. Ability to work under pressure and prioritize tasks effectively. Certifications (Optional ): Heavy machinery operation certification, safety and quality certifications relevant to workshop operations.
